Hiring the Right Contractors



Finding the best service providers for your commercial outside paint job can make all the difference in attaining a specialist finish. Start by researching regional business with solid track records. indoor painting twin cities on the internet reviews and ask for referrals from various other entrepreneur.

When you've got a shortlist, demand thorough quotes that detail expenses, timelines, and materials used. This will help you compare each professional's offerings successfully.

Do not forget to inquire about their experience with commercial jobs similar to your own. Verify their licensing and insurance coverage to protect yourself from prospective liabilities.
